Section 1: From Reactive Commands to Proactive Conversations

The fundamental difference between the current smart home and a generative AI-powered one lies in the transition from reactive programming to proactive understanding. Today’s systems operate on “if-this-then-that” (IFTTT) logic, which is powerful but limited. A generative AI-driven home, however, operates on context, history, and inferred intent, creating a fluid, conversational relationship between the user and their environment.

Understanding Context and Intent

A generative AI assistant can process complex, multi-part requests that would baffle current systems. Instead of saying, “Hey Google, turn on the living room lights to 50%,” “Set the thermostat to 70 degrees,” and “Play my ‘Relaxing Evening’ playlist,” you could simply say, “I’m home from a long day at work, help me unwind.” The AI would interpret this vague request based on context. It knows the time of day, it might have access to your calendar (seeing you had a stressful meeting), and it remembers your past preferences. Consequently, it orchestrates the perfect ambiance: dimming the AI Lighting Gadgets News-worthy smart bulbs, adjusting the climate, starting your favorite playlist through the latest AI Audio / Speakers News, and perhaps even suggesting you order dinner from your favorite restaurant via an integration with AI Phone & Mobile Devices News.

The Role of Multimodal AI and Sensor Fusion

This deep understanding is fueled by multimodal AI, which processes and synthesizes information from various sources beyond just voice. This is a major topic in AI Sensors & IoT News. Your home’s AI will integrate data from:

  • Vision: The latest in AI-enabled Cameras & Vision News allows the system to recognize who is home, detect if you’re carrying groceries (and suggest pre-heating the oven), or see that the kids have left toys on the floor and dispatch a device from the world of Robotics Vacuum News.
  • Sound: Beyond voice commands, it can recognize the sound of a crying baby, a smoke alarm, or breaking glass, triggering appropriate alerts or actions through integrated AI Security Gadgets News.
  • Sensors: Data from motion, temperature, humidity, and air quality sensors provide a constant stream of environmental context.
  • Wearables: Information from your smartwatch or fitness tracker, a key area in Wearables News, can inform the home about your stress levels, sleep quality, or if you’ve just returned from a run, prompting it to cool the house down and suggest a recovery smoothie.

This fusion of data, processed on powerful AI Edge Devices News for privacy and speed, allows the home to build a rich, dynamic understanding of its inhabitants and their activities, enabling it to act as a truly proactive partner.

Ethical Considerations: Privacy and Security in the Sentient Home

A home that sees, hears, and understands everything presents significant privacy and security challenges. The constant data collection required for personalization is a double-edged sword. This makes the latest AI Monitoring Devices News both exciting and concerning. How is this deeply personal data stored, protected, and used? The push towards on-device processing, central to AI Edge Devices News, is a critical step in mitigating these risks by keeping data within the home’s local network. Consumers must demand transparency from manufacturers about their data policies. Furthermore, the potential for these systems to be hacked is a serious threat, making robust security protocols, as highlighted in AI Security Gadgets News, non-negotiable. We must establish clear regulations and industry standards to ensure that the convenience of a smart home does not come at the cost of our fundamental right to privacy.

Tips for Consumers

  1. Prioritize Privacy: Research a brand’s privacy policy before buying. Favor companies that prioritize on-device processing and offer clear data management controls.
  2. Start Small: You don’t need to automate your entire home at once. Begin with a single, high-quality device, like a next-generation smart speaker or display, to understand how it fits into your life.
  3. Build a Cohesive Ecosystem: To get the most out of generative AI, your devices need to communicate. Stick with major ecosystems (like Google Home, Apple HomeKit, or Amazon Alexa) that are actively integrating these new AI capabilities.
  4. Secure Your Network: Your home Wi-Fi network is the gateway to your smart devices. Use a strong, unique password, enable WPA3 encryption, and consider a separate network for your IoT devices.
